New Zealand, the All Whites, are the dominant force within the Oceania Football Confederation — six-time OFC Nations Cup winners — and have qualified for the FIFA World Cup in 1982, 2010, and 2026, with their 2010 campaign unique for being the only team not to lose a single match while still exiting in the group stage.

Egypt's Pharaohs are the most decorated national team in Africa Cup of Nations history, having lifted the trophy a record seven times, and were the first African side to appear at the FIFA World Cup when they competed in the 1934 tournament in Italy. Led by Mohamed Salah, one of the world's best players, Egypt return to the 2026 World Cup looking to end a long wait for global glory.
